357944754154306656482218721333542091707929600
Even
357944754154306656482218721333542091707929600 is even
Previous even number is 357944754154306656482218721333542091707929598
Next even number is 357944754154306656482218721333542091707929602
Cubed
45861473692088181811321871041024856246458254796272221561558938822803386481524332507034578753523287652362746688556977561414926336000000
Squared
128124447026587032413991115398580004861764977860585013356210561480984119630751518556160000
Binary
10000000011010000000100010111010011100011010111101110000000000010001100000010011110010111111101000001100001111101111000001100110010000101010000000000